[New Taipei City News] The new season of "New Taipei Theater," now in its third year, took off today (8th), kicking off the New Taipei City Documentary Film Awards series of activities. To actively expand its international reach, the New Taipei City Government's Department of Information has invited Jian Manshu, who is not only an actress but also a director and screenwriter. Jian won the Golden Bell Award for Best Supporting Actress in a Drama Program in 2021 for her performance in the drama "The Arc of Life." She serves as the annual event ambassador, jointly witnessing the excitements at 30,000 feet.

 

Today (8th), the New Taipei City Government's Department of Information held the "2024 New Taipei Theater Press Conference." New Taipei City Mayor Hou Youyi, EVA Air President Clay Sun, and event ambassador Jian Manshu jointly announced that starting today, selected works from the new season of the "New Taipei City Documentary Film Awards" will be available on EVA Air's in-flight entertainment system on all routes. Following the positive feedback from last year's diverse broadcasting channels, the documentary films of the "New Taipei City Documentary Film Awards" will also be available on the LINE TV online video platform. At the press conference, event ambassador Jian Manshu shared the highlights of the documentaries and announced upcoming online and offline lectures, outdoor screenings, and other activities, inviting everyone to watch and experience the charm of documentary films together.

The "2024 New Taipei Theater" will continue its two-month period of screening, featuring 12 selected documentary films showcasing diverse themes and different life experiences. The films include: in May, director Hsu Chinglun's "Poetry of Life," director Zhang Hong-Jie's "Hearing from the Dolphin," and director Yu Chiaoting's "Family"; in July, director Lu Hsiaowen's "Child Portrait," director Zhang Surong's "The Journey of Becoming Truku" and directors Chiu Chi Liang and Li Jingru's "25 Kg"; in September, director Shih Yu-Lun and Lin Hao-shen's "The Man Who Cannot Be Excluded," director Wu Po-hung's "The TASHI Village," and director Chen Weicih's "Elephant on the Island"; and in November, director Lin Huan-wen's "Grand Slam Dream," director Chou Shao-Chiang's "Andy and Ailin," and director Li I-hsuan's "Mutualism," inviting global travelers to enter the world of documentaries.
